Palpitations are usually reported as a fluttering in the chest or a feeling that the heart has jumped. A person may experience palpitations during times of stress, such as after several days with less sleep than normal, or before a test or an important meeting. Caffeine, nicotine, and medications such as cold tablets may be factors in bringing on the attacks. Another factor is a sudden change of position, such as getting out of bed too quickly or jumping up to answer the telephone. With palpitations, the heartbeat regulator has trouble adjusting to the quick switch from a circulatory system that is horizontal to one that is vertical. The pulse rate must be changed, and because of this, the heart may skip a few beats, similar to the way in which a car motor misses a beat as it goes from driving on a flat road to climbing a hill.
